South African Police Service (SAPS) spokesperson Captain FC van Wyk said the motive for both shootings is unknown and it is yet to be determined if the incidents were gang-related.
A 33-year-old man was shot at Turflyn Walk, Hanover Park at approximately 13:45. The victim was transported to a local medical facility where he succumbed to his injuries.
Later, at approximately 21:06, the police responded to another shooting in the area. The body of a 23-year-old man was found at Silica Walk.
